在springboot中使用jna,怎么在callback中注入service以保存数据

callback正常调用sout没问题,一旦注入保存数据的service就保错,

img


Redis的注入报这个,我注入其他的数据库报错,service会包另外的错,但是在其他地方注入可以正常使用,就是在这个callback函数里各种报错

报什么错

Caused by: java.lang.NullPointerException 这的关键信息看一下

因为你的数据有字段为空导致报错

空指针异常了,你查看下你的代码,方法中字符串转成jsonObject对象的代码行出错了,是不是字符串为空或者没有获取到object对象,然后又调用object对象的其他方法导致的

空指针在fastjson 应该是对象反序列化的问题,不懂可以问我